
redis是一款高性能的NoSQL数据库,被广泛应用于Web应用、缓存、消息队列等场景。但是,由于Redis的数据都存储在内存中,一旦 服务器 发生宕机或重启,数据就会丢失。为了解决这个问题,Redis提供了持久化功能,将数据保存到磁盘中,以保障数据的安全和可靠性。
Redis支持两种持久化方式:RDB和AOF。RDB是指定时将内存中的数据快照保存到磁盘中,而AOF则是将每个写操作追加到一个日志文件中。两种方式各有优缺点,需要根据实际情况选用。
RDB持久化
RDB持久化是将Redis当前状态保存到一个快照文件中。保存方式可以是手动或自动,由配置文件中的save参数来定义。当Redis满足以下条件之一时,就会自动执行持久化操作:
– 在给定时间内键被修改次数超过给定次数。
– 在给定时间内至少发生了给定数量的键修改操作。
– 在给定时间内Redis空闲进程(无客户端连接)的时间超过给定时长。
手动执行RDB持久化操作可以使用命令save和bgsave,分别为阻塞和后台执行方式。bgsave命令不会阻塞Redis的服务进程,但可能会占用较长的时间和资源,由于bgsave操作不是实时操作,所以会存在最多5秒的数据丢失风险。
配置文件示例:
# 每900秒执行一次RDB持久化save 900 1# tell Redis to save after 900 seconds and 1 changesave 300 10save 60 10000# 快照文件名及保存目录设置dbfilename dump.rdbdir /usr/local/redis/data

在上述配置中,表示Redis每900秒执行一次RDB持久化,或者在该时段内数据被修改了1次以上,就会执行一次持久化操作。同时,指定了快照文件的名称为dump.rdb,保存在目录/usr/local/redis/data中。
AOF持久化
AOF持久化是将每个写操作以日志形式追加到一个日志文件中。AOF文件中的命令可以重新执行以还原数据,只要在Redis启动时加载该文件即可。AOF文件通常比RDB文件更大,但AOF文件中包含的信息更完整。AOF持久化有3种策略:每秒钟fsync一次、每写入n个命令fsync一次、停止写入时fsync一次。
配置文件示例:
# 打开AOF持久化功能appendonly yes# 开启fsync以保证写操作能及时写入磁盘appendfsync everysec# 非实时fsync策略,每100次写入操作执行一次fsync#appendfsync no#appendfsync 100# AOF文件名及保存目录设置appendfilename "appendonly.aof"dir /usr/local/redis/data
在上述配置中,表示开启了AOF持久化功能,每秒钟将当前的写操作记录到AOF文件中,并以人类可读的格式展示出来,同时指定了AOF文件的名称为appendonly.aof,保存在目录/usr/local/redis/data中。

RDB和AOF持久化同时使用
可以将RDB和AOF持久化方式同时启用,以增强数据安全性。RDB可以提供一个快速的数据库还原速度,而AOF可以保证尽可能完整地恢复数据。假设想了解任何时候可能发生的数据丢失量,只需要计算最后一次成功执行BGSAVE和AOF的时间之间的数据丢失量即可。
配置文件示例:
save 900 1save 300 10save 60 10000# 同时打开RDB和AOF持久化功能appendonly yesdir /usr/local/redis/datadbfilename dump.rdb
在上述配置中,指定了RDB的快照保存时间和条件,同时打开AOF和RDB持久化功能,并指定目录和文件名。
总结
Redis持久化功能是保障数据安全和可靠性的必要手段。根据实际情况选择合适的持久化策略(RDB、AOF或两者兼而有之),并且根据数据变更的频率、数据的价值等设定适当的保存策略和时间,以达到最佳的持久化效果。在实践过程中,还应考虑到硬件、网络等因素,以确保数据正常保存。
香港服务器首选树叶云,2H2G首月10元开通。树叶云(www.IDC.Net)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。
你知道精油和香水的区别吗
众所周知,精油和香水都是让人体散发出香味,那二者是不是就当成同一种东西用,或者可以混淆使用。 下边我们来说说精油的起源,和个人认为的一点点区别香水的创造时期应该是在欧洲的古时候,而西方人创造香水的原因是。 一来是由于西方人整体体味比较重,不分男女,有些味让人受不了,才会研制出香水这种让人散发出香味的东西,遮住体味。 二来是,古欧洲贵族们经常喜欢社交,但是由于本身体味比较重,又加上不爱洗澡(在古欧洲迷信,洗澡太勤会容易生病),所以为了避免在社交上的尴尬,所以就发明了这种,用来掩盖体臭的香水。 而精油了,是由于在欧洲中世界,瘟疫霍乱各种传染病的盛行,人们偶然间发现,香水制造师,被传染的机率比一般人要低的多,后来人们就在街上烧乳香,家中点燃植物油制作的蜡烛,来遏阻,传染病的扩散。 后来在法国的一位化字工程师,在一次实验的意外中发现熏衣草提取的精油在治疗疗伤方面有奇效,于是就把把这种熏衣草提取的精油用于治疗受炮火灼伤的士兵,它的经验证实了植物精油在科学上的立论根据,植物精油因其极佳的渗透性,而能达到肌肤的深层组织,进而被细小的脉管所吸收,最后经由血液循环,到达被治疗的器官。 此后又有多位科学家更加一起努力的推广精油用于,皮肤,精油,生理等各方面的疾病,并逐渐发现,和精油配合的按摩手法,让精油外用发挥最大的功效。 而精油疗法,才逐渐广为人知,和大家的认可。 所以精油的诞生基本上都和医疗,预防有很大的关系。 香水是一种混合了香精油、固定剂与酒精或乙酸乙酯的液体,用来让物体(通常是人体部位)拥有持久且悦人的气味。 精油取自于花草植物,用蒸馏法或脂吸法萃取,也可使用带有香味的有机物。 固定剂是用来将各种不同的香料结合在一起,包括有香脂、龙涎香以及麝香猫与麝鹿身上气腺体的分泌物。 酒精或乙酸乙酯浓度则取决于是香水、淡香水还是古龙水。 香水的保存期限通常是五年。 精油和香水虽然都有香气,但是由于精油的成分很复杂,身体对精油的承受能力比较有限,都是用滴来用的,香水却没有限制,可千万不要混淆使用,那样对皮肤很不好的。 关于精油的优势,我们就不多说了,在以前的文章中提到很多。 说一下二个主要的用途吧:香水,主要是在公众场和,参加各种聚会前,让人们使用。 而精油一般,我们是用来对皮肤和身体的养护,一般都是在家里,进行各种保养的时候用。 所以说这二个,一个主内,一个主外。 阿芙精油简介: ”AFU阿芙”品牌,源自希腊神话中“爱与美的女神”之名,现在化身为精油和植物护理品界的全球合作典范。 其品牌核心价值,是捍卫精油行业的秘密———得花材者得天下———坚持不向中间商采购,只和全球最佳产地庄园合作,长期契约种植。 每一滴阿芙精油,从田间种植到入瓶灌装,都做到血统清晰,品质纯正。 ”AFU阿芙”在中国的推广,以一二线城市高端商场形象专柜为主,到目前已覆盖二十余个城市的两百多家商场,作为领导品牌,无论专柜拓展速度还是用户口碑,都遥遥领先。
什么是网络信息系统安全体系结构?
随着信息化进程的深入和互联网的快速发展,网络化已经成为企业信息化的发展大趋势,信息资源也得到最大程度的共享。 但是,紧随信息化发展而来的网络安全问题日渐凸出,网络安全问题已成为信息时代人类共同面临的挑战,网络信息安全问题成为当务之急,如果不很好地解决这个问题,必将阻碍信息化发展的进程。 1、安全攻击、安全机制和安全服务 ITU-T X.800标准将我们常说的“网络安全(networksecurity)”进行逻辑上的分别定义,即安全攻击(security attack)是指损害机构所拥有信息的安全的任何行为;安全机制(security mechanism)是指设计用于检测、预防安全攻击或者恢复系统的机制;安全服务(security service)是指采用一种或多种安全机制以抵御安全攻击、提高机构的数据处理系统安全和信息传输安全的服务。 三者之间的关系如表1所示。 2、网络安全防范体系框架结构 为了能够有效了解用户的安全需求,选择各种安全产品和策略,有必要建立一些系统的方法来进行网络安全防范。 网络安全防范体系的科学性、可行性是其可顺利实施的保障。 基于DISSP扩展的一个三维安全防范技术体系框架结构,第一维是安全服务,给出了八种安全属性(ITU-T REC-X.800--I)。 第二维是系统单元,给出了信息网络系统的组成。 第三维是结构层次,给出并扩展了国际标准化组织ISO的开放系统互联(OSI)模型。 框架结构中的每一个系统单元都对应于某一个协议层次,需要采取若干种安全服务才能保证该系统单元的安全。 网络平台需要有网络节点之间的认证、访问控制,应用平台需要有针对用户的认证、访问控制,需要保证数据传输的完整性、保密性,需要有抗抵赖和审计的功能,需要保证应用系统的可用性和可靠性。 针对一个信息网络系统,如果在各个系统单元都有相应的安全措施来满足其安全需求,则我们认为该信息网络是安全的。 3、网络安全防范体系层次 作为全方位的、整体的网络安全防范体系也是分层次的,不同层次反映了不同的安全问题,根据网络的应用现状情况和网络的结构,我们将安全防范体系的层次划分为物理层安全、系统层安全、网络层安全、应用层安全和安全管理。 1.物理环境的安全性(物理层安全) 该层次的安全包括通信线路的安全,物理设备的安全,机房的安全等。 物理层的安全主要体现在通信线路的可靠性(线路备份、网管软件、传输介质),软硬件设备安全性(替换设备、拆卸设备、增加设备),设备的备份,防灾害能力、防干扰能力,设备的运行环境(温度、湿度、烟尘),不间断电源保障,等等。 2.操作系统的安全性(系统层安全) 该层次的安全问题来自网络内使用的操作系统的安全,如Windows NT,Windows 2000等。 主要表现在三方面,一是操作系统本身的缺陷带来的不安全因素,主要包括身份认证、访问控制、系统漏洞等。 二是对操作系统的安全配置问题。 三是病毒对操作系统的威胁。 3.网络的安全性(网络层安全) 该层次的安全问题主要体现在网络方面的安全性,包括网络层身份认证,网络资源的访问控制,数据传输的保密与完整性,远程接入的安全,域名系统的安全,路由系统的安全,入侵检测的手段,网络设施防病毒等。 4.应用的安全性(应用层安全) 该层次的安全问题主要由提供服务所采用的应用软件和数据的安全性产生,包括Web服务、电子邮件系统、DNS等。 此外,还包括病毒对系统的威胁。 5.管理的安全性(管理层安全) 安全管理包括安全技术和设备的管理、安全管理制度、部门与人员的组织规则等。 管理的制度化极大程度地影响着整个网络的安全,严格的安全管理制度、明确的部门安全职责划分、合理的人员角色配置都可以在很大程度上降低其它层次的安全漏洞。
格力变频空调什么模式最省电?
ECO模式最省电,使用时只要按下遥控器的ECO键即可。 空调eco模式的节能模式,通过降低空调启停机频率,在不影响制冷的情况下降低耗电量。 比如普通模式下的空调一般连续运行8小时需要耗电8.5度左右,而开启eco模式的空调8个小时只耗电2.3度。 采用新一代高金镀换热器,提升空调的热交换效率。 同时,在高金镀换热器表面喷一层亲水涂层,具有防油和防污能力,保证空调热交换器持久高效。 扩展资料比ECO模式稍稍费电的模式叫做睡眠模式:睡觉形式,它在黑夜敞开的时分,每隔2个小时就会上升1度,这么黑夜睡觉的时分敞开,那么能在到达舒服的情况下,愈加省电。 睡觉形式能削减室内温度跟设置温度的差值,使压缩机停止运作,然后到达省电的意图。 睡觉形式在将风速主动调小的情况下,还能下降空调运作的噪音。
发表评论